WalkthroughThe change adds documentation guidance for WebAssembly (WASM) package configuration in the build configuration section. A new dedicated WASM subsection is introduced with a code example demonstrating how to declare external WASM packages in build.external. The external-packages note is updated to expand its scope from mentioning only native binaries to cover both native binaries and WebAssembly packages, replacing previous specific examples.
